Jennifer Aniston has been reeling since the heartbreaking death of her father, John Aniston, on November 11, 2022. He was a beloved soap star, playing the villainous yet always entertaining Victor Kiriakis on "Days of Our Lives" since 1985. John had changed over the years since his debut on the sudser and at one point in his life considered entering into the field of medicine.
